If the doors/hood or liftgate (wagon) are not closed and you press the
remote entry transmitter twice to confirm the doors are locked, the horn
will chirp twice to warn you that a door/hood or liftgate (wagon) is still
open.

Disarming the system

You can disarm the system by any of the following actions:
• Unlock the doors by using your

remote entry transmitter.

• Unlock the doors by using your

keyless entry pad.

• Unlock the doors or liftgate with a key. Turn the key full travel

(toward the front of the vehicle) to make sure the alarm disarms.

• Turn ignition to ON.
• Press the PANIC control on the

remote entry transmitter. This
will only shut the horn OFF when
the alarm is sounding. The alarm
system will still be armed.

Triggering the anti-theft system
The armed system will be triggered if:
• Any door, liftgate or hood is opened without using the door key or the

remote entry transmitter.

• The trunk is forced opened.
